Output 171f33d6729b6ac39ec15c51e7e2a031342c4a5f4e9d7880e0cb034aff58db41:1

value
152865000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01f537b9a98f749f8d23379cee41b34de9d38671 OP_EQUAL
address
9rcd6c1cR8PQh11WbAuxZXD4k84WbZvn1E
transaction
171f33d6729b6ac39ec15c51e7e2a031342c4a5f4e9d7880e0cb034aff58db41